转发一篇好文 —— 《What We Talk About When We Talk About Agent Infra》

6 小时 49 分钟前
 d0r1an

https://me.0xffff.me/agent_infra.html?

473 次点击
所在节点    程序员
9 条回复
maolon
4 小时 36 分钟前
有意思, 所以他的意思就是把 agent 的 workfow 应拆净拆到一个 atomic 语义的步骤然后把各个步骤固定化和容器化以应对 scale 和不确定性问题?
d0r1an
3 小时 24 分钟前
@maolon 是的,超强的抽象能力
d0r1an
3 小时 21 分钟前
我按照这个抽象实现了一个 SkillBox

https://github.com/boxlite-ai/boxlite/pull/170
Reminders
2 小时 47 分钟前
agent 执行环境的不隔离,执行过程产生的副作用的确是现实问题。

如果把 skills 和执行环境打包,做到无外部依赖、无副作用、可重用、规模化。也许是个不错的方向。
d0r1an
2 小时 45 分钟前
Reminders
2 小时 29 分钟前
@d0r1an #3 我没太明白这个怎么使用,是在 python 中调用这个 SkillBox 么,这个 SkillBox 是不是也应该像 docker 一样提供一个打包好的 image 呢?
d0r1an
2 小时 14 分钟前
@Reminders 这个 skill 是跑在微型虚拟机里面的,独立内核。目的是让 agent 或者 app 调用,例如文章提到的 buy coffee skill
Reminders
1 小时 48 分钟前
@d0r1an #7 意思是,如果把项目部署在服务器上,我想为每一个用户分配一个 skill_box ,那么每个用户都可以通过

boxlite.SkillBox() as skill_box

创建一个 skill_box 使用是吗?无法服务重启,用户可以无负担在再次创建出一个 skill_box 重新使用嘛?
Cbdy
1 小时 17 分钟前
有趣的思路

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/1189623

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X